Book Price $0 : The 6th edition of 'Personal Finance' by Jack Kapoor et al. is an essential guide for individuals striving to navigate the often complex world of personal economic management. This comprehensive textbook delves into fundamental personal finance concepts such as budgeting, saving, investing, taxation, and insurance. The authors methodically present strategies to manage personal finances effectively, addressing the challenges of contemporary economic environments. Key themes include financial goal setting, retirement planning, credit management, and the subtleties of real estate investments.
